Output 5696c80ad78df43c8cb1a79ec34f6df61d09e000e7c2a4097874b1ee2b035c35:36

value
845926201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cf103cfe7a41438e594bd785ffb4401f15688d1 OP_EQUAL
address
MBzngsw1EhkuuCaUVLBgZTz6XzLdrEPWZL
transaction
5696c80ad78df43c8cb1a79ec34f6df61d09e000e7c2a4097874b1ee2b035c35
spent
true